Who Youll Work With
Corebridge Financial Private Credit Group (PCG) invests across several asset classes including Corporate Privates (CP) Infrastructure Structured Credit (Asset Backed Securities and Collateralized Loan Obligations) and Direct Lending. These investments are typically long-term fixed rate debt securities issued by public or private companies outside of the public bond market in a range of industries and geographies.
About the role
In this Senior Investment Analyst role you will support Structured Credit deal teams in evaluating new transaction opportunities and monitoring a portfolio of existing investments. The analyst will be exposed to all aspects of the underwriting process and given the opportunity to develop fundamental credit investing skills. New investment recommendations and amendment and restructuring negotiations must be conducted using good judgment on credit structure and pricing with the goal of providing appropriate levels of protection and return for the risk taken.

Compensation
The anticipated salary range for this position is $90000 - $105000 at the commencement of employment. Not all candidates will be eligible for the upper end of the salary range. The actual compensation offered will ultimately be dependent on multiple factors which may include the candidates geographic location skills experience and other qualifications. In addition the position is eligible for a discretionary bonus in accordance with the terms of the applicable incentive plan.
